Output c85886691ffa204b58a0e918b07260b80b434a3a3a30fc84df384759efa68152:3

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 831c939ec20a017ef9ac76016367978e33d5df9f
address
bc1qsvwf88kzpgqha7dvwcqkxeuh3ceathulljhazm
transaction
c85886691ffa204b58a0e918b07260b80b434a3a3a30fc84df384759efa68152
spent
true